NVD · unedited
Use of Hard-coded Cryptographic Key vulnerability in Mitsubishi Electric GX Works3 versions from 1.000A and later allows a remote unauthenticated attacker to disclose sensitive information. As a result, unauthenticated attackers may view programs and project file or execute programs illegally.

Hard-coded cryptographic key vulnerability in Mitsubishi Electric GX Works3 allows remote unauthenticated attackers to decrypt sensitive project data, view programs and project files, and potentially execute programs illegally. The key is embedded in the software itself, enabling attackers to bypass authentication and access plaintext sensitive information.
